Old-School Soul Is Still in Session: thewarandtreaty, Billy Valentine and William Bell (WBellMusic) have all recently released albums that not only draw from the soul-music tradition but also add something valuable to it.

Old-school soul music—much like swing, reggae, British Invasion rock or countless other once-popular genres—may have lost its market share, but it has not lost its musical value. Soul has entered that cultural twilight zone, where it is neither a major force nor mostly forgotten.

African-American religious music had evolved from “spirituals” to “gospel” in the 1930s by incorporating a heavy dose of the blues. The pivotal figure Thomas Dorsey had recognized that the bawdy excitement of the blues could be translated into exultant worship music. Charles merely revealed that the door could swing both ways.

The War and Treaty, the Nashville duo of Michael and Tanya Trotter, straddles the border between gospel and soul on their new, fourth album,. Five of the 10 songs are plainly secular love songs and three are explicitly religious. The other two are intriguingly ambiguous—as if to show how interchangeable the sentiments are.

“Blank Page,” for example, begins with a low-key, vocal-and-piano opening, builds to a peak, subsides to a churchy piano interlude before rebuilding to a big crescendo. “The Best That I Have” celebrates chilling at home with a lover with a silky understatement right out of the Smokey Robinson Quiet Storm playbook.

This was obvious when Martin Luther King, an Atlanta pastor, made his “I Have a Dream” speech in 1963. And it was unmistakable when Sam Cooke turned those sentiments into a song, “A Change Is Gonna Come,” the following year. By the late ’60s and early ’70s, artists such as Sly Stone, Curtis Mayfield, Stevie Wonder, Marvin Gaye, Donny Hathaway, the Staples, Parliament-Funkadelic, the Temptations and War were transforming gospel materials into soul protest on a regular basis.
